From what I understand their A/C are excellent and the area is a great place to train. Where else can you fly Cessnas, Tiger Moths and Harvards all in the same week?

As for standards etc. it may be best, if you havn't already, to contact Malcolm Spaven their UK representative, I've always found him to be very approachable and should give you contact details for anyone who has gone ahead of you.

Can't get better references than from those who have already done the course.

As Clive Hughes says, never pay the full amount upfront.
